6.1 General Configuration Registers
GENERAL CONFIGURATION REGISTERS (0X00…0X1F)
R/W
Addr
n
Register
Description / bit names
RW
0x00
11
GCONF
Bit
GCONF – Global configuration flags
0..2
Reserved, set to 0
3
poscmp_enable
0: Encoder 1 A and B inputs are mapped.
1: Position compare pulse (PP) and interrupt output
(INT) are available, Encoder 1 is unused.
4
enc1_refsel
0: N channel 1 mapped depending on interface to
SWIOP (if SW_SEL=0) or IO0 (if SW_SEL=1).
1: N channel 1 mapped to REFL1.
5
enc2_enable
0: Right reference switches are available.
1: Encoder 2 A and B signals are mapped to REFR1
and REFR2 inputs.
6
enc2_refsel
0: N channel 2 mapped depending on interface to
SWION (if SW_SEL=0) or IO1 (if SW_SEL=1).
1: N channel 2 mapped to REFL2.
7
test_mode
0: Normal operation
1: Enable analog test output on pin REFR2
TEST_SEL selects the function of REFR2:
0…4: T120, DAC1, VDDH1, DAC2, VDDH2
Attention: Not for user, set to 0 for normal operation!
8
shaft1
1: Inverse motor 1 direction
9
shaft2
1: Inverse motor 2 direction
10
lock_gconf
1: GCONF is locked against further write access.
R+C
0x01
4
GSTAT
Bit
GSTAT – Global status flags
0
reset
1: Indicates that the IC has been reset since the last
read access to GSTAT.
1
drv_err1
1: Indicates, that driver 1 has been shut down due
to overtemperature or short circuit detection
since the last read access. Read DRV_STATUS1 for
details. The flag can only be reset when all error
conditions are cleared.
2
drv_err2
1: Indicates, that driver 2 has been shut down due
to overtemperature or short circuit detection
since the last read access. Read DRV_STATUS2 for
details. The flag can only be reset when all error
conditions are cleared.
3
uv_cp
1: Indicates an undervoltage on the charge pump.
The driver is disabled in this case.
